Mayak Avocado (Korean) Recipe

Ingredients:

2 cloves garlic, chopped
1 or 2 red Thai chili, chopped
2 green onion, chopped
2 TBSP fresh lemon juice
1/4 cup soy sauce
1/4 cup water
1 tbsp agave nectar or your choice of sweetener
Pinch of black pepper
1 tsp sesame seeds
2 firm but ripped avocado, peeled and cut into large chunks
2 oz of diced cucumber or cherry tomatoes

Directions:

1. Combine chopped garlic, chili peppers, green onion, lemon juice, soy sauce, water, agave nectar, black pepper, and sesame seeds in a large airtight container. Give a good mix.
2. Cut avocados into large chunks and add into marinate sauce. Add your choice of diced cucumber or cherry tomatoes.
3. Carefully cover avocado chunks with marinade, be gentle because avocados are easy to break down. You can serve immediately or cover and marinate for 30 minutes before serving. You can serve by itself as a snack/appetizer, pair with crackers, make avocado toast or serve with warm cooked rice. Enjoy!

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
4
